“Green” Oxidant (Oxygen) Mediated Synthesis of N -(2-(Methylsulfonyl)ethyl)amide Derivatives Using DMSO as a Dual Synthon and Solvent

Sulfone derivatives are important components of many pharmaceuticals. This Letter reports an efficient method for synthesizing N -(2-(methylsulfonyl)ethyl)amide compounds with sulfone skeletons from amide compounds and dimethyl sulfoxide (DMSO) using an environmentally benign oxidant (oxygen). This metal-free protocol features operational simplicity, a low-cost and nonhazardous oxidant mediator, good functional group tolerance, and scalability to gram-scale. Notably, DMSO acts as a dual synthon donor, providing both methylene (−CH 2 −) and methylsulfonyl (−SO 2 Me) groups to form C(sp 3 )–N and C(sp 3 )–C(sp 3 ) bonds while serving as the solvent. A radical mechanism is proposed based on control experiments and EPR spectroscopy.
